State Pension and the Frozen £12,570 Personal Allowance: What 2026/27 Means for Retirees
The full new State Pension rose to £12,547.60 a year on 6 April 2026, just £22 below the frozen £12,570 personal allowance. Here is how the freeze affects retirees with private pensions, savings, and other income.

Pension Lifetime Allowance Abolished 2026: What Replaced It and How the New Lump Sum Rules Work
The pension lifetime allowance was fully abolished from 6 April 2024. No cap on total pension savings. But two new allowances replaced it — the Lump Sum Allowance (£268,275) and the Lump Sum and Death Benefit Allowance (£1,073,100). Annual allowance stays at £60,000 for 2026/27. This HMRC-valid
